Summary
Pregnancy and childbirth discrimination. Prohibits an employer from discriminating against a pregnant employee. Requires an employer to provide reasonable employment accommodations for a pregnant employee. Requires the civil rights commission to investigate complaints and attempt to resolve complaints.
